The … WebJan 7, 2015 · Generally the form is [expression of negative opinion using negative grammar] + "I don't think". For example: I didn't sleep very well, I don't think. => I think I slept poorly. I won't get there very early, I don't think. => I think I will arrive late.
WebStudents will read a thought on a task card, decide whether it should be kept inside their head (think it) or if it can be said out loud (say it), and place it on the appropriate mat. This activity can be done in small groups or as a whole-class activity. This resource includes: 1 x ‘Think It’ mat. 1 x ‘Say It’ mat. 22 scenario cards.
